Summary
Privilege escalation in beego
Details
beego is an open-source, high-performance web framework for the Go programming language. An issue was discovered in file profile.go in function GetCPUProfile in beego through 2.0.2, allows attackers to launch symlink attacks locally.
Severity ?
7.8 (High)
